A trainer, in the context of PC gaming, is a separate program that runs alongside a game, injecting modified values into its memory to alter gameplay in real-time. For a title as vast as Oblivion, a comprehensive trainer would offer a staggering array of functionalities. Core features would undoubtedly include the manipulation of character attributes: setting Strength to god-like levels, maxing out all Skills instantly, or providing infinite Magicka and Health. This bypasses the grind, allowing players to engage with the game's systems from a position of ultimate power. Beyond the character, trainers typically offer inventory control, spawning any item, weapon, or piece of armor at will, and granting limitless gold. Crucially, for a game focused on exploration, features like teleportation, no-clip mode (walking through walls), and the ability to freeze in-game time are transformative. They turn the world into a pure playground for experimentation and sightseeing, divorced from survival constraints.

The use of a trainer fundamentally alters the philosophical contract between player and game. Oblivion's intended experience is one of gradual progression, risk, and consequence. A trainer dismantles these pillars, creating a new paradigm centered on narrative agency, creative freedom, and systemic exploration. A player might use invincibility not to "win" easily, but to calmly observe the intricate details of an Ayleid ruin without enemy interruption. Infinite spells allow for experimenting with the game's often-unwieldy magic system as a true Arch-Mage would. The ability to instantly acquire any item can facilitate role-playing a character of noble birth or a legendary artifact hunter from the story's outset. In this sense, the trainer becomes a narrative and mechanical director's tool, enabling players to craft their own unique stories outside the boundaries of the designed progression curve.

Any discussion of an "Oblivion Remastered Trainer" must consider the technical landscape. A true remaster would likely be built on a more modern iteration of the Creation Engine, with updated memory addressing and security protocols. A functional trainer would require significant reverse-engineering effort from the modding community to locate and safely modify the new memory values for health, attributes, and inventory pointers. Compatibility is paramount; the trainer must not cause crashes, corrupt save files, or interfere with the remaster's potential new features like improved physics or lighting systems. Furthermore, the ideal trainer would be modular, allowing users to toggle specific features on and off to create a customized blend of challenge and freedom, rather than applying an all-or-nothing suite of cheats.

The community surrounding Oblivion has always been its lifeblood, and trainers amplify this collaborative, creative spirit. They serve as foundational tools for content creators. Machinima artists use trainers to control character positioning, freeze animations, and manage inventories to stage complex scenes. Mod testers utilize no-clip mode to rapidly navigate to specific locations to check for conflicts or bugs. For the average community member, sharing specific trainer-enabled "challenges" or storytelling scenarios becomes a form of gameplay in itself. Imagine community events where players, using a controlled set of trainer commands, attempt to conquer the Imperial City with an army of spawned creatures or recreate historical battles from Tamrielic lore. The trainer transitions from a solitary tool to a catalyst for shared, user-generated experiences.
